WebPartner organizations can also apply together with one lead applicant (one proposal for all partners). For proposals with two or more organizations, the lead applicant can receive a maximum of $50,000 per year and will be legally responsible for sub-granting and allocating remaining funds to each co-applicant in accordance with the approved budget.
